II. Historic Evolution of Advertising
A. Early Forms of Advertising
Advertising, in different types, has actually been an important part of human history because ancient times. Early civilizations used rudimentary techniques to promote goods and services, leveraging fundamental interaction strategies to reach prospective customers. Some early types of advertising include:
- Pictorial Signage: In ancient marketplaces, traders used pictorial indications and signs to recognize their stores and suggest the items they used. These visual hints worked as an early form of branding and helped illiterate individuals recognize companies.
- Town Criers: In middle ages Europe, town criers played an important function in disseminating details and advertising events. They would openly reveal news, pronouncements, and commercial messages, serving as human "loudspeakers" for businesses and authorities.
- Handbills and Posters: In the 17th and 18th centuries, printed handbills and posters became popular advertising tools. These advertising products were plastered on walls, trees, and other public spaces to inform the regional community about products, services, and occasions.
B. The Birth of Modern Advertising
The Industrial Revolution in the 19th century caused substantial modifications to the advertising landscape. Developments in innovation and mass production, coupled with the growth of urban centers, produced brand-new chances for services to reach larger audiences. Key milestones in the birth of modern advertising consist of:
- Newspapers and Magazines: With the rise of industrialization and the printing press, papers and publications became prominent advertising platforms. Organizations began positioning paid ads in publications, targeting particular demographics based on readership.
- Branding and Logos: As competitors increased, companies acknowledged the requirement for differentiation. They began adopting logos and mottos to establish brand identities that customers could recognize and trust.
- Advertising Agencies: In the late 19th century, the very first advertising agencies were developed, marking a shift from specific services handling their promotions to specific firms using advertising services. These companies brought a more tactical and innovative technique to advertising.

Online Banner Ads
Online banner advertisements are one of the earliest and most identifiable types of digital advertising. These graphical advertisements are displayed on websites, usually at the top, bottom, or sides of a page. Banner advertisements can be fixed images, animated gifs, or perhaps interactive multimedia components. They intend to get the attention of website visitors and direct them to the marketer's site or landing page. The success of banner ads relies on compelling visuals, memorable copy, and tactical advertisement positioning on relevant websites.
Social Media Advertising
The rise of social media platforms has reinvented how companies reach their target audience. Social network advertising involves producing and promoting advertisements on popular social networks such as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, LinkedIn, and others. These platforms offer advanced targeting choices based on demographics, interests, behaviors, and even custom-made audience segments. Social media ads can take various formats, including image ads, video ads, carousel ads, and sponsored posts. The interactive and extremely interesting nature of social media advertisements allows brands to develop strong connections with their audience and drive conversions.
Online Search Engine Marketing (SEM)
Search Engine Marketing (SEM) is a kind of paid advertising that aims to increase a site's presence on search engine results pages (SERPs). It involves bidding on specific keywords appropriate to business, and when users look for those keywords, the advertisements appear at the top or bottom of the search results page. SEM can be highly reliable as it targets users actively searching for product and services connected to the advertiser's offerings. Google Ads (previously referred to as Google AdWords) is the most popular platform for SEM, but other online search engine like Bing also provide comparable advertising chances.
Email Marketing
Email marketing remains a potent tool for services to connect with their existing and prospective customers. It involves sending out targeted emails to a thoroughly curated list of subscribers. These emails can serve different functions, such as promoting brand-new products, supplying exclusive offers, sharing valuable material, or nurturing leads through automated drip campaigns. Email marketing can be extremely individualized, allowing services to customize messages based upon user choices and habits. To be successful, email marketing requires compelling material, well-designed design templates, and compliance with anti-spam regulations.
